FDA-cleared for treating snoring and mild to moderate sleep … WebDec 13, 2024 · The average cost for a sleep apnea mouth guard is estimated at $1800 – $2000. This includes the actual sleep apnea mouthpiece, dentist visits, adjustments, follow-ups, and modifications to the dental device. Most health insurance companies and Medicare cover oral devices for sleep apnea.

It has a similar look and function to some retainers or mouthguards that athletes might use. If you grind your teeth or clench your jaw while sleeping, then a night guard can protect your teeth from damage.
